Context: Why the Gulf Reassessment Matters for Crypto

Gulf states—Saudi Arabia, UAE, Qatar—are the linchpins of the petrodollar system. For decades, the US provided security guarantees in exchange for oil priced in dollars and recycled into US Treasuries. That bargain is now under review. The Kyiv Post report, citing Gulf officials, confirms that Iran tensions are accelerating a structural reassessment of the US alliance. This isn’t a diplomatic spat; it’s a fundamental shift in the global reserve currency architecture.

Let’s break down the mechanics. The Gulf states hold three critical leverage points: oil production policy, dollar asset holdings, and arms procurement. All three are now being weaponized. In 2023, Saudi Arabia and Iran restored diplomatic ties under Chinese mediation. The UAE joined BRICS. OPEC+ cuts have been sustained despite US pressure. These are not isolated moves—they are a coordinated strategy to diversify away from single-superpower dependency.

2. Dollar Asset Diversification

Gulf sovereign wealth funds—the Abu Dhabi Investment Authority, Saudi PIF, Qatar Investment Authority—collectively manage over $3 trillion. These funds are heavily weighted in US Treasuries. Any signal of diversification into other assets (gold, yuan, Bitcoin) would be a seismic event. In 2025, Saudi Arabia’s finance minister hinted at considering yuan-denominated oil contracts. That’s cheap talk for now, but if the security reassessment deepens, the talk becomes action. 3. Arms Procurement and Tech Transfer

The Gulf states are the world’s largest arms importers, with the US as the dominant supplier. The reassessment is already pushing them toward alternative suppliers: China’s Wing Loong drones, Turkey’s TB2, and European Eurofighters. This is not just about hardware—it’s about technology transfer. The US restricts sensitive tech (AI, missile guidance, nuclear energy). The Gulf wants that tech for their own defense industrialization. If the US blocks, they go to China or Russia.
